Output fcc2c7dc6b7a46056b283f502fa1e58137bc7a33f8af4265d00a1d77b4149a05:0

value
8701624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1a44e07830d93ce970124b7c24c525b2d1d032 OP_EQUAL
address
3HZay8NLM2AgHUxjThTPdMCYcdnqLmk4de
transaction
fcc2c7dc6b7a46056b283f502fa1e58137bc7a33f8af4265d00a1d77b4149a05
confirmations
46756
spent
true